代码工具 架构图
## 简介
在软件开发过程中,我们经常需要使用各种代码工具来帮助我们提高开发效率、优化代码质量和管理项目。这些代码工具可以帮助我们自动生成代码、自动化测试、进行版本控制和构建等。本文将介绍一些常见的代码工具以及它们在软件开发中的应用。
## 代码生成工具
代码生成工具可以根据一些预定的模板和规则,自动生成代码片段或者整个代码文件。它可以帮助我们减少重复劳动,提高开发效率。
原创
2024-01-01 03:45:51
130阅读
每个代码编辑器都会声称自己是最好的,然而你需要的可能只是唯一一款代码编辑器。下面是一些主流的、好评度高的代码编辑器,各位开发者不妨看看是否有适合自己的。记事本也可以编写代码 ,但是一个好的代码编辑器不仅仅是一个简单的文本编辑工具,这是发生奇迹的地方,开发者编写的代码会转化为更大的项目的可用组件。鉴于这一重要性,难怪开发者会对与他们日夜共处的代码编辑器如此挑剔。每个开发者都希
转载
2023-10-13 22:59:54
40阅读
# 静态代码复查工具架构图解析
在现代软件开发中,代码质量是一个至关重要的指标。静态代码复查工具(Static Code Analysis Tools)是保证代码质量的重要工具之一。本文将通过一个架构图来探讨静态代码复查工具的工作原理,并结合实例进行分析。
## 静态代码复查工具的工作原理
静态代码复查工具在软件开发的早期阶段运行,分析代码而不执行它。它们通过一系列规则和标准对源代码进行分析
dhm-echarts
echarts3图表封装,前台ajax通过自定义div属性实现传值,后台通过各种数据适配器自动组装达到图表封装,以实现echarts图表展示,也可以自定义适配器。以及分析预测echarts图表拟合曲线算法。项目地址:项目交流QQ群:551709145 验证码:码云目录1 Maven项目说明1.1 web项目部署(echarts min 部署)1.2 we
# 如何实现“架构图代码”
## 概述
作为一名经验丰富的开发者,你需要教导一位刚入行的小白如何实现“架构图代码”。在这篇文章中,我将会告诉你整个流程,并指导你每一步需要做什么,包括使用的代码和其注释。让我们一起来完成这个任务吧!
## 流程步骤
首先,让我们来看一下整个实现“架构图代码”的流程,可以通过下面的表格展示: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 确
原创
2024-05-15 06:20:20
16阅读
# 如何实现代码架构图
在软件开发过程中,代码架构图是重要的工具,用于帮助我们理解系统的结构以及不同模块之间的关系。今天,我将教你如何实现一个基本的代码架构图,并介绍整个流程和所需的代码。以下是我们将要经历的步骤:
| 步骤 | 描述 |
| ------------ | -------------
要成为一名软件架构师,绝非一夜之间或一次晋升那么简单。这是一个角色,而不是一个级别。这是一个循序渐进的过程,你会逐渐获得这个角色所需的经验和信心。做好软件架构需要从哪几方面入手呢?软件一 Beyond Compare关于代码对比软件,我只推荐你使用Beyond Compare代码对比软件!Beyond Compare目前最新版本是4,只需用简单而强大的操作命令,即可开启最优质的对比体验,找出你感兴
转载
2023-09-18 23:20:42
337阅读
大家好,我是独立开发者Larry~当一个想法在你的脑海中越来越清晰的时候,想要把它实现为产品的意愿也会逐渐增强,这个时候你需要做的就是把产品的内容信息尽可能构架完善,用流程图、思维导图、组织结构图或者站点地图都是不错的选择,而且这类工具也很多,不过每个的侧重点不尽相同。今天就给大家推荐几个不错的工具供你选择,我个人比较喜欢Whimsical系列,感兴趣的朋友可以试试。http://D
转载
2023-07-18 00:29:59
417阅读
流程图是表示算法、工作流或流程的一种框图表示,它以不同类型的框代表不同种类的步骤,每两个步骤之间则以箭头连接。这种表示方法便于说明解决已知问题的方法。流程图在分析、设计、记录及操控许多领域的流程或程序都有广泛应用。那么,业务流程图怎么做呢?本文将为大家详细讲解。使用工具:GitMind软件介绍:GitMind是一款免费简单易上手的流程图软件,支持在Windows、Mac系统浏览器上直
转载
2023-08-23 13:29:08
297阅读
# 如何实现“业务架构图工具”
## 引言
作为一名经验丰富的开发者,你经常会遇到一些刚入行的小白需要指导的情况。在本次任务中,你需要教会一位新手如何实现“业务架构图工具”。通过本文,你将了解整个流程,并且学会每一步需要做什么以及使用的代码。让我们开始吧!
## 整个流程
首先,让我们通过下表展示整个实现“业务架构图工具”的流程:
| 步骤 | 操作 |
|------|------|
|
原创
2024-06-29 05:38:37
29阅读
# 如何实现一个Mac架构图工具
在这篇文章中,我将帮助你了解如何实现一个简单的“Mac架构图工具”。该工具的核心功能是以图形方式展示模块之间的关系。我们将分步骤进行说明,同时为每个步骤提供代码示例。最后,我们会通过一个简单的示例来整合这些步骤。
## 流程概览
以下是实现“Mac架构图工具”的基本流程:
| 步骤 | 描述
介绍代码检查可以有效的提高代码质量,更进一步的说代码检查不仅仅是为了提高代码质量,已深入到代码程序的逻辑检查、内存使用情况的检查甚至更高层面的检查,很大程度上影响了程序的功能和性能。代码检查分类动态检查:程序运行时检查,侧重于内存和资源使用情况检查静态检查:指不运行被测程序本身,仅通过分析或检查源程序的语法、结构、过程、接口等来检查程序的正确性。代码静态检查带来的好处帮助程序开发人员自动执行静态代
转载
2023-10-31 23:12:09
96阅读
1.Spring Spring 是一个开源 框架,是为了解决企业 应用程序开发复杂性而创建的。框架的主要优势之一就是其分层架构,分层架构允许您选择使用哪一个组件,同时为J2EE 应用程序开发提供集成的框架。Spring 框架的功能可以用在任何J2EE 服务器中,大多数功能也适用于不受管理 的环境。Spring 的核心要点是:支持不绑定到特定J2EE 服务的可重用业务和
转载
2023-07-10 13:55:10
323阅读
前言程序员不是专门写代码的吗,只要把代码写得足够优雅就行了呀,为什么还要画图?画好图呢?没错!一图胜千言,对复杂问题进行分析分解,再通过图形化的表达方式,来描述业务或者技术上的逻辑,可以说事半功倍!今天作者就带大家认识一些常见的图、图的画法以及常用的画图工具。思维导图英文名称是The Mind Map,也叫做心智导图,脑图,心智地图,脑力激荡图,灵感触发图,概念地图,树状图,树枝图或思维地图。它是
转载
2023-07-10 14:06:18
488阅读
制作流程图的工具有很多种,比如,Visio、Axure、Smartdraw、Omnigraffle(Mac)等等,产品经理只需要选择一款适合自己的工具即可。1. VisioVisio是微软推出的一款流程图制作工具,也是目前产品经理最常用的一款流程图工具。通过Visio可以方便、快速地把业务流程、系统实现流程画出来。它本身有很多的组件库,可以很方便的完成各类流程图、结构图和网络图的制作。Visio的
转载
2023-07-26 22:37:24
458阅读
优良架构的一个重要特点就是通过组件分层使模块间的依赖流畅贯穿于整个架构。如何描述和维护组件间的依赖是一个常见却又很难解决的工作。UML包图(package diagram)提供了描述这种依赖的方法,但是创建包图往往很耗费时间,甚至在反向工程时,获得一个直观的设计也需要很长的时间。此外,UML也不能有效地进行修正,用它来维护大型且复杂的系统的依赖图,投资回报率往往很小。依赖结构矩阵(Dependen
转载
2023-12-02 13:19:18
90阅读
如果你要问我思维导图工具有什么用,那么我想告诉你它就像你手边的稿纸和铅笔一样,是帮助你快速将脑中一堆杂乱的关键字和逻辑关系顺序整理出来的利器,而且还能让你静下心来! 思维导图,一个可以更系统化、结构化导出你的思维的工具。对梳理知识,架构想法, 收集灵感, 头脑风暴, 策划项目等等都有很大的帮助。主流的思维导图应用一般是框图、树状图的形式。下面介绍几款超实用的软件,真真切切提高你的办事效
转载
2023-07-28 10:15:36
233阅读
文章目录前言一、什么是思维导图?二、思维导图的绘制要点三、使用GitMind工具快速制作思维导图总结 前言在解决复杂问题时,有一个非常实用的工具就是思维导图,它简单易上手。其实在大二时老师有讲过思维导图的绘制,但是自己一直懒得用,一是习惯了记文字笔记,二是平常编码用的是电脑,惧怕在线工具的学习成本。 但是笔者最近在找开源项目,设计项目模块时,用传统笔记方式已经不太能胜任了,痛定思痛之下,决定学一
转载
2023-08-22 22:02:15
137阅读
在现代软件开发中,架构图是理解系统结构与交互关系的重要工具。本文将探讨如何通过代码生成并绘制架构图,使用多种可视化工具和技术实现。这一过程不仅加深了我们对系统架构的理解,同时也提供了可视化的参考依据。以下是整个过程的详细记录。
## 背景描述
随着软件系统日益复杂,团队成员间对架构的理解可能会出现偏差。为了解决这一问题,使用可视化工具生成架构图显得尤为重要。这里我们使用四象限图来展示项目管理中
在进行代码分析架构图的创建时,我们往往需要一个清晰的框架来指导这个过程。本文将详细阐述如何通过多个面向技术的图表和代码示例来实现这一目标。
背景描述
在软件开发中,清晰的代码分析架构图可以帮助团队更好地理解系统的结构及各组件间的交互。从项目的初期阶段就开始构建这样的架构图,可以有效地缓解后期维护和扩展时可能遇到的问题。以下是我们为流程图设计的基础框架,它展示了从需求分析到架构设计、实现代码的完